UND flying team wins Region V 'SAFECON' and advances to national competition

The UND Flying Team won top honors in the Region V National Intercollegiate Flying Association’s (NIFA’s) Safety and Flight Evaluation Conference (SAFECON) recently.

UND’s winning score of 672 points gave the UND Flying Team first place in flight events and first in ground events. This SAFECON was hosted by UND in Crookston, Minn., and comprised teams from: University of Dubuque, Minnesota State University – Mankato, St. Cloud State University, University of Minnesota – Crookston and UND.

“The team came together and was ready for this air-meet,” said Lewis Liang, assistant professor of aviation and the team’s faculty advisor. “We have achieved our first goal this year, which now allows us to advance to the National Competition in 2011.”

The National SAFECON competition will be held in Columbus, Ohio, on May 16, 2011, and hosted by The Ohio State University. Thirty teams from the 11 regions around the country will compete in that National SAFECON event.

The UND Flying Team comprises aviation students who have made a voluntary commitment of their time and effort to be a part of the team. The team participates in two competitions annually: a regional qualifying competition and the national competition to determine the national championship.

The UND Flying Team members who competed were Jamie Marshall, captain; William Gardner, captain; and Brandon Anderson, David Edmonds, Jacob Lange, Matthew McGrath, Scott Meyer, Louisa Millar, Lauren Peterson, Kyle Schurb, Paul Valenstein, and Tyler Van Heel.

The UND Flying Team is a member of the National Intercollegiate Flying Association (NIFA), the sanctioning body for the regional and national SAFECON competitions. SAFECON places a special emphasis on safety of flight operations.

UND’s Flying Team has won 16 of the last 26 national competitions, including the 2009 and 2010 National Championship.
